Was not at all what we expected. But once we got over the fact that we had another 9 days in this version of paradise we made the best of our situation.

We started on the Island of Nacula, right at the top and stayed at a resort called Oarsmans Bay Lodge which was alright, apart for my two bed mates that woke me up in the middle of the night flapping around (cockroaches). This was the best beach of all of the Islands we visited.

We then went to Taweva Island and stayed at Coral View Resort which was lovely, I didn't have any bed guests for the 2 nights whilst we were there, so I was very grateful for that. The atmosphere there was great, and I think this was our favourite place- they made really nice cakes!

We then went to Coconut Bay View on Naviti- I would give this one a miss- the staff there were really miserable and the food was not great. There were two other resorts, White Sandy Beach and Korovou, which were much nicer.

We then went to Kuata Natual Resort and spent 2 nights there, we met up with people we met at Coral View and met some more- it was so fun and the food there was very good too!

We then went to Bounty Island, where they filmed Celebrity Love Island. The beach was georgeous, the food was great, a bit on the expensivie side but all not motorised activites were included so it kinda paid for itself. Though we didn't get the chance to use the facilities as the weather turned to rain and wind the day we were there. We went and had a nosey at the Love Shack, which has been completely gutted. I didn't actually watch CLI but a die hard fan that was there filled me in on the set up. It's a shame that they gutted it, it would have been a lovely honeymoon bungalow or perfect for girly holidays!

We then went to South Sea Island, the one closest to the mainland- again everyone met up there so we had a laugh. The snorkelling was amazing, and I was even tempted to do a dive, but the weather, again was not great so we gave it a miss.
